Following up on the Marrowgate stale-cache postmortem: this change looks correct, but please verify the TTL and refresh-ahead values against what we agreed in the incident review, since the bug stemmed from a refresh window longer than the TTL itself. For reference, the agreed constants are these.

tuning table, faduf-baduf:
PRIORITIES = {
    "ulavan": 191,
    "silys": 750,
    "goriel": 238,
    "kelmir": 66,
    "wendor": 432,
}

## Nightly reindex for Corvette Search

Moves the Haverlane catalog reindex from hourly incremental to a full nightly rebuild. Incremental updates drifted from source after deletes; the nightly job rebuilds from scratch and swaps aliases atomically. New folks: the job runs on the batch cluster, not the serving tier, so a failed run never degrades queries — it just serves yesterday's index. Pager alerts fire on two consecutive failures. Job tuning constants follow.

constants for tafog-kahag:
RATE_LIMITS = {
    "sorir": 697,
    "oliox": 683,
    "holax": 176,
    "casox": 60,
    "pelius": 382,
}

# Env file — Cartwheel dispatch, driver-assignment heuristic
# Scope: staging only. Do not promote to prod.
# The heuristic weights (proximity, shift balance, refusal rate) are tuned
# for the Velmont pilot region and will misbehave elsewhere.
# Review notes: heuristic service runs unprivileged; it reads weights
# read-only from the tuning store and writes nothing back.
# Only one sensitive value exists in this file: the tuning-store access
# credential, consumed at boot and never logged.
# That credential is set on the following line.

secret setting of faduf-bahop: LEDGER_TOKEN8=c3b363be